+ChriBli Posted April 30, 2022 Share Posted April 30, 2022 I've seen this happen before. That time it was a cache that was supposed to be published at a specified date and time (to coincide with an event) but was published by mistake before that. The reviewer or the owner immediately noticed the mistake and the listing was retracted until the proper time. The notification emails had already gone out though. Quote Link to comment
